Click the Backup button to initiate the configuration file backup. Configuration Backup to TFTP This window is used to initiate a configuration file backup to a TFTP server. To view the following window, click Tools > Configuration Restore & Backup > Configuration Backup to TFTP, as shown below: Figure 11-18 Configuration Backup to TFTP Window The fields that can be configured are described below: Parameter TFTP Server IP Source File Description Enter the TFTP server IP address here. When select the IPv4 option, enter the IPv4 address of the TFTP server in the space provided. When the IPv6 option is selected, enter the IPv6 address of the TFTP server in the space provided. Enter the source filename and path of the configuration file located on the Switch here. This field can be up to 64 characters long. • Select the running-config option to back up the running configuration file from the Switch. • Select the startup-config option to back up the start-up configuration file from the Switch. Destination File Enter the destination path and location where the configuration file should be stored on the TFTP server. This field can be up to 64 characters long. Click the Backup button to initiate the configuration file backup. Configuration Backup to FTP This window is used to initiate a configuration file backup to an FTP server. 133
